探讨加筋环代替拉筋带在矿山工程支护中的应用

摘  要:加筋环的主要作用是将填料垂直产生的侧向压力转由加筋环来承担。其技术优势在于:加筋体受力状态易于测试和分析,理论计算可靠符合实际。且加筋环材料比塑性拉筋带成本低效果好。加筋环还具有对填料要求低,易于防腐持久耐用,便于施工等优点。The main function of stiffened rings is to transfer the lateral pressure generated vertically by fillers to the stiffened rings. Its technical advantage is that the stress state of the reinforced body is easy to test and analyze, and the theoretical calculation is reliable and practical. Moreover, the stiffening ring material has lower cost and better effect than the plastic stiffening belt. Stiffened rings also have the advantages of low filling requirements, easy corrosion resistance, durability and easy construction.
